However, the volatility of crypto prices can add a twist to the gaming session. A win in Litecoin might be worth less in Australian dollars by the time you convert it back, depending on the market swing. This financial juggling act is something players need to weigh up, balancing the fun of the game against the reality of fluctuating asset values. It’s not just about hitting the jackpot; it’s about knowing what that jackpot is actually worth when the smoke clears.

The Legal Lay Of The Land

Offering online casino-style games like online pokies to Australians is largely prohibited under federal law, which puts a significant cloud over the industry. This regulation is designed to protect players and maintain integrity, but it also drives much of the action into grey markets or offshore sites. For anyone looking at crypto casino Litecoin slots AUD, understanding this legal boundary is crucial because it affects player protections and recourse if things go pear-shaped.

Regulators argue that strict laws are necessary to prevent problem gambling and ensure that operators aren’t preying on vulnerable locals. They point to the social costs of gambling addiction and the need for a controlled environment where age verification and responsible gaming measures are enforced. From this viewpoint, allowing unregulated crypto slots could open the floodgates to unscrupulous operators who don’t care about the welfare of the community.

On the flip side, proponents suggest that prohibition doesn’t stop the behaviour, it just drives it underground where there are no safeguards. They argue that a regulated crypto market could offer better oversight than the current wild west scenario. It’s a classic debate between control and freedom, with valid points on both sides of the fence regarding how best to manage the risk while respecting player choice.
